Eastern Chimpanzee

Pan troglodytes schweinfurthii (♂)
Western Region, Uganda

This male chimp is referred to as "Mr. Black" by park rangers. He's 38 years old (same as me), which is old for a wild chimpanzee. We watched him for an hour while he sat and ate palm fruits.

Oak bracket fungus (Inonotus dryadeus)

29/09/2024

I went on a walk with a friend around Selattyn and Weston Rhyn looking for new things for my Flickr. Found no new plants, but did find this fungus. Well it was not hard to miss seeing it from afar as of it's size. I'm a 6,3 tall marfan's girl, and I would say the biggest bracket was around 50cm across.


Oak bracket fungus (Inonotus dryadeus) scientific classification.

Superdomain: Neomura
Domain: Eukaryota
(unranked): Opisthokonta
Kingdom: Fungi
Subkingdom: Dikarya
Phylum: Basidiomycota
Subphylum: Agaricomycotina
Class: Agaricomycetes
Order: Hymenochaetales
Family: Hymenochaetaceae
Genus: Inonotus
Species: I. dryadeus
